Heat Risk Analysis
Shire of Harvey in Western Australia faces elevated extreme heat risk. The Bureau of Meteorology (BOM) reports that Australia's average temperature has increased by approximately 1.5 °C since 1910, with the frequency of extreme heat days rising across most regions.
The urban heat island (UHI) effect can make built-up areas of Shire of Harvey warmer than surrounding rural areas, particularly on summer nights. Dark roof materials, limited tree canopy cover, and heat-absorbing surfaces contribute to localised heat stress that varies by property.
Heatwaves are becoming more frequent and intense.

What heat mitigation measures work best in Shire of Harvey?
Effective heat mitigation includes light-coloured roofing (cool roofs), ceiling and wall insulation, double-glazed windows, external shading, cross-ventilation design, and increasing tree canopy around the property. These measures reduce indoor temperatures and cooling costs.
